tsx-ts-mode: fill-paragraph doesn't work for doc-comments

> On Apr 11, 2025, at 4:51 AM, Konstantin Kharlamov <Hi-Angel <at> yandex.ru> wrote:
>
> On Fri, 2025-04-11 at 11:34 +0300, Konstantin Kharlamov wrote:
>> CC: Yuan Fu as the author of the code in question.
>>
>> What happens in the code makes sense: since the comment resides at
>> top-
>> level, the parent of any top-level statement (returned by (treesit-
>> node-parent node)) is, well, beginning of a buffer.
>>
>> So the question is, why the check works that way.
>
> Please see the attached patch, it'd seem this is exactly the fix that's
> expected here. Basically, the problematic check is specific to Rust
> treesitter mode, so shouldn't be executed in other languages. The patch
> factors out the entire check to a separate function and adds additional
> condition of (eq major-mode 'rust-ts-mode).
>
> Tested in tsx-ts-mode, it fixes the problem.
> <1.patch>
Thanks! Your analysis is correct. But I don’t want to hard-code rust-ts-mode in the function, since modes with other names can very well use rust parser. I pushed 9d43715baa5 that operates in the similar vein as your patch. Instead of checking for the current major mode, I tighten the condition by adding an additional check that ensure the parent node is a comment node. So now if the parent node is the root node (as in your initial example), the condition should fail. Please see if it fixes your problem.
Yuan
